The wide prevalence of gluten-related disorders has led to increase in the demand for gluten-free foods. Rice is a gluten-free and less allergenic cereal. However, bread made from rice flour, i.e., gluten-free rice bread, is generally of poor quality because rice flour cannot develop a network with gluten-like properties. In this study, we investigated the effects of protease treatment on gluten-free rice to improve the quality of its bread. Bread treated with a commercial protease from Bacillus stearothermophilus (thermoase) was of higher quality, i.e., good crumb appearance, high volume, and soft texture, depending on the amount of enzyme added. Rice proteins in the protease-treated bread were analyzed by sodium dodecyl sulfate-polyacrylamide gel electrophoresis, which showed that glutelins and prolamins were hardly digested by thermoase in comparison with other proteins. Scanning electron microscopy revealed that many cellular structures were formed in the thermoase-treated bread; however, these structures were rare in the untreated control. Bread crumb color was not affected by the treatment. The staling rate was much lower for the thermoase-treated bread than for the control. These results indicate that thermoase treatment can be successfully used to improve the quality of gluten-free rice bread by partial digestion of rice proteins. 相似文献

Synaptic inputs on dendrites are nonlinearly converted to action potential outputs, yet the spatiotemporal patterns of dendritic activation remain to be elucidated at single-synapse resolution. In rodents, we optically imaged synaptic activities from hundreds of dendritic spines in hippocampal and neocortical pyramidal neurons ex vivo and in vivo. Adjacent spines were frequently synchronized in spontaneously active networks, thereby forming dendritic foci that received locally convergent inputs from presynaptic cell assemblies. This precise subcellular geometry manifested itself during N-methyl-D-aspartate receptor-dependent circuit remodeling. Thus, clustered synaptic plasticity is innately programmed to compartmentalize correlated inputs along dendrites and may reify nonlinear synaptic integration. 相似文献

Dose responses of plasma calcitriol, calcium (Ca), bone metabolic markers and glomerular filtration rate (GFR) were evaluated in four nonpregnant Holstein cows treated subcutaneously with an aqueous formulation of calcitriol at four doses in a 4 × 4 Latin-square design. Calcitriol, Ca, and markers of bone metabolism were analyzed in plasma samples. GFR was measured in predose and day 5 samples. Plasma calcitriol and Ca concentrations increased dose-dependently. The calcitriol dose was positively correlated with the area under the concentration-time curve of plasma calcitriol. Bone formation markers tended to increase from day 3 onward for all doses. No significant changes in GFR were noted. Thus, exogenous calcitriol administered between 0.0625 and 0.5 μg/kg body weight elicited dose-dependent increases in both plasma calcitriol and Ca and elevated bone formation markers without affecting renal function in nonpregnant cows. 相似文献

The present report describes a rare case of spontaneous hemangiosarcoma in a nine-week-old
male Sprague-Dawley rat. At necropsy, multiple white nodules of various sizes were observed on
and within the enlarged spleen and liver and were histopathologically determined to be composed
of spindle- to oval-shaped cells that showed invasive growth without encapsulation and were
arranged solidly but partially in whorls or faint alveolar patterns with vascular-like spaces
containing small clefts or erythrocytes in the tumor mass. Immunohistochemical analysis
revealed that most of the tumor cells were strongly positive for vimentin, von Willebrand
factor (vWF) and CD34 but negative for podoplanin. In addition, electron microscopic
examination revealed the presence of Weibel-Palade bodies in the cytoplasm of the tumor cells.
Based on these findings, this case was diagnosed as a hemangiosarcoma. The splenic masses were
larger than the hepatic ones, with tumor cells mainly observed at periportal regions with tumor
embolism in the liver, suggesting that primary hemangiosarcoma initially developed in the
spleen before metastasizing. 相似文献

Porencephaly was observed in a female cynomolgus monkey (Macaca fascicularis) aged 5 years and 7 months. The cerebral hemisphere exhibited diffuse brownish excavation with partial defects of the full thickness of the hemispheric wall, and it constituted open channels between the lateral ventricular system and arachnoid space. In addition, the bilateral occipital lobe was slightly atrophied. Histopathologically, fibrous gliosis was spread out around the excavation area and its periphery. In the roof tissue over the cavity, small round cells were arranged in the laminae. They seemed to be neural or glial precursor cells because they were positive for Musashi 1 and negative for NeuN and GFAP. In the area of fibrous gliosis, hemosiderin or lipofuscin were deposited in the macrophages, and activated astroglias were observed extensively around the excavation area. 相似文献

The aim of this study was to investigate the risk factors for tail chasing behaviour that occurs when a dog spins in tight circles to chase its tail, sometimes biting it. The behaviour is a sign of canine compulsive disorder (CD). A questionnaire about tail chasing behaviour and general information about the animals was used to collect data on seven breeds of pet dogs. The data were gathered at a dog event and at veterinary practices. To determine which variables were associated with tail chasing behaviour, stepwise multiple regression analyses were performed. Regardless of cohort, 'breed' and 'source of acquisition' were significantly associated with tail chasing behaviour. Using a chi-square test, the association between 'source of acquisition' and the behaviour was examined separately in two breeds (Shiba inu and Dachshund) that had the largest number of individuals chasing their tails accompanied by biting and/or growling at them. This factor showed a significant and consistent association across the two breeds. With respect to the risk factors of 'breed' and 'source of acquisition', high percentages of Shiba inu and dogs originating from pet stores were included in the group chasing their tails with biting and/or growling. The results suggest that distinct risk factors exist for tail chasing behaviour and such factors appear to be regulated by both genetics and the environment. 相似文献

We previously described that supplementary garlic, onion and purple sweet potato (PSP) enhance humoral immune response in White Leghorn chickens. In the present in vitro study, we investigated the effects of garlic (GE), onion (OE) and PSP (PSPE) extracts on proliferation, interleukin (IL)‐2 and interferon (INF)‐γ gene expression of stimulated lymphocytes. The effects on microbicidal activity, reactive oxygen species (ROS) and nitric oxide (NO) productions of stimulated peritoneal macrophages were studied as well. The results showed that GE augmented Concanavalin A (ConA)‐induced splenocytes (4, 8 and 16 µg/mL) and thymocytes (2, 4 and 8 µg/mL) proliferations, and gene expression of IL‐2 (8 and 16 µg/mL) and INF‐γ (16 µg/mL). None of the examined extracts had mitogenic effect nor stimulated bursacytes response to phorbol 12‐myristate 13‐acetate (PMA). Macrophages exhibited superior microbicidal activity and ROS production with GE at 4 and 8 µg/mL and with OE at 25.6 µg/mL. None of the extracts showed stimulatory effects on NO production. The extracts showed concentration‐dependent inhibitory effects on all measured parameters at higher concentrations. Taken together, it is likely that garlic has direct stimulatory effects on immune cell functions, whereas the in vitro inhibitory effects of onion and PSP were likely attributed to high flavonoid contents. 相似文献

In our previous studies, a clear kinetic isotope effect was observed when a pair of carbohydrate model compounds, methyl ??-d-glucopyranoside (MGP??) and a deuterated MGP?? labeled at the anomeric (methyl ??-d-(1-2H)glucopyranoside) or C-2 position (methyl ??-d-(2-2H)glucopyranoside), was reacted with active oxygen species (AOS) generated by reactions between O2 and a phenolic compound, 2,4,6-trimethylphenol (TMPh), under oxygen delignification conditions. These results indicate that the AOS abstract the anomeric and C-2 hydrogens of MGP??. Contrarily, no clear kinetic isotope effects were observed when AOS were generated by reactions between O2 and another phenolic compound, 4-hydroxy-3-methoxybenzyl alcohol (vanillyl alcohol, Valc), and hence, the abstraction of the anomeric and C-2 hydrogens by the AOS was not confirmed. In this study, a pair of MGP?? and the deuterated MGP?? labeled at all the positions, (2H3)methyl ??-d-(1,2,3,4,5,6,6-2H7)glucopyranoside, was reacted with AOS generated from TMPh or Valc under oxygen delignification conditions to further examine the appearance of a kinetic isotope effect. A clear kinetic isotope effect was observed when either of TMPh or Valc was the origin of AOS, indicating that some AOS abstract at least a hydrogen of MGP?? in either case. The results are further discussed focusing on the type of AOS generated from TMPh and Valc. 相似文献

Equine anxiety trait is considered an important temperament in various situations, including riding, training, and daily care. This study examined the polymorphism of the equine serotonin transporter (SLC6A4) gene as a candidate genetic element influencing equine anxiety trait. The sequence of the coding region of this gene was highly homologous with those of other mammals, and four single nucleotide polymorphisms were found by comparing the sequences of ten genetically unrelated thoroughbred horses. Radiation hybrid mapping revealed that this gene was located 26.92 cR from neurofibromin 1 on ECA 11. Using two-year-old thoroughbred horses (n=67), the association of these polymorphisms with the anxiety trait was examined, but no significant association was identified between each haplotype of the serotonin transporter gene and the anxiety score. 相似文献
